There are two sorts of settings accessible for your Yahoo account so as to design it with any third-part email customer application.

IMAP server settings

Approaching Mail (IMAP) Server

Server - imap.mail.yahoo.com

Port - 993

Requires SSL - Yes

Active Mail (SMTP) Server

Server - smtp.mail.yahoo.com

Port - 465 or 587

Requires SSL - Yes

Requires confirmation - Yes

Your login data

Email address - Your full email address

Secret key - Your record's secret phrase

Requires validation – Yes

POP server settings

Approaching Mail (POP) Server

Server - pop.mail.yahoo.com

Port - 995

Requires SSL - Yes

Active Mail (SMTP) Server

Server - smtp.mail.yahoo.com

Port - 465 or 587

Requires SSL - Yes

Requires TLS - Yes (if accessible)

Requires validation – Yes

Your login data

Email address - Your full email address

Secret phrase - Your record's secret phrase

Requires confirmation – Yes
